Depositing Money from Bank to Binance: A Step-by-Step Guide for Beginners


In today's digital age, cryptocurrencies have become an increasingly popular investment and trading option. Among the numerous cryptocurrency exchanges available, Binance stands out as one of the largest and most user-friendly platforms, offering a wide range of cryptocurrencies to trade. However, before you can start buying and selling cryptocurrencies on Binance, you need to deposit money into your account from your bank account. This guide will walk you through the process step by step, making it easy for beginners to complete this task successfully.


Step 1: Opening a Binance Account


Firstly, if you haven't already done so, sign up for a Binance account by visiting their website and clicking on "Trade" or "Futures/Spot" depending on your preference. You will need to provide personal information such as your full name, email address, phone number, date of birth, and nationality. After confirming your identity, you'll receive an SMS confirmation code to verify your phone number. Once verified, proceed with the account creation process.


Step 2: Verifying Your Bank Account


To deposit money from your bank to Binance, you need to link a bank account to your Binance account by initiating a verification process. This step is crucial for anti-money laundering (AML) regulations and helps protect both the platform and its users. Here's how to do it:


1. Log in to your Binance account and navigate to "My Asset" or "Assets" under the "Wallet" tab on the top menu bar.


2. Click on "Bank Card Deposit & Withdrawal," which is located right beneath the total asset value section.


3. You will be prompted to select a bank card type. Choose between Binance USD (BUSD) and USDT (Tether) if you wish to deposit funds directly via your bank account in these cryptocurrencies' fiat equivalents.


4. Click on "Create Card" after selecting the appropriate currency.


5. You will be required to enter your bank details, including your full name, bank name, IBAN (International Bank Account Number) or SWIFT/BIC code, and a confirmation number sent via SMS to your registered phone number.


6. Once you've entered this information, Binance will issue the virtual card linked with the chosen currency.


Step 3: Fund Your Binance Account from Your Bank


After successfully verifying your bank account, it is time to fund your Binance account. Here are the steps:


1. Go back to "My Asset" or "Assets" in the "Wallet" tab and click on "Bank Card Deposit & Withdrawal" again.


2. Select the newly created card you wish to deposit into.


3. Look for the "Deposit" button under the corresponding currency's section, which will then open a form requesting your bank transfer details.


4. Enter your IBAN or SWIFT/BIC code along with your full name as it appears on your bank account and the amount you wish to deposit.


5. Select the appropriate bank account from the dropdown menu if multiple options are available, and provide any additional information required by Binance for the transfer process.


6. Click "Send Deposit Instructions" and wait for a confirmation email with an activation code.


7. Enter the activation code within 10 minutes to complete the deposit instruction submission.


8. Finally, you need to make your bank transfer according to the instructions provided in the email. Once the money is transferred, Binance will send you an email notification once it has received and deposited the funds into your account.
